Mahila Nāla
Mahila Nāla is a stream in Uttar Pradesh, Plains. Mahila Nāla is situated nearby to the locality Surauli Khurd, as well as near Dallār.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hamirpur
Town
Hamirpur is a town and a municipal board in Hamirpur district in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. Located just above the confluence of the Yamuna and Betwa rivers, it is the administrative headquarters of Hamirpur district. Hamirpur is situated 4 km northwest of Mahila Nāla.
